Key Considerations Before Starting the EB-5 Process
Before you begin your EB-5 journey, it’s vital to ask the right questions. This ensures you’re fully prepared and reduces the risk of unexpected challenges.

1. Have You Assessed Your EB-5 Eligibility?
The EB-5 program is designed for high-net-worth individuals. You must invest at least $1.05 million (or $800,000 in a Targeted Employment Area) and meet strict program requirements post-investment. Even if you use an EB-5 visa loan, you’ll need to demonstrate substantial personal wealth.
2. Have You Created a Realistic Budget?
Beyond the investment amount, factor in administrative, legal, and unforeseen costs. A detailed budget—ideally prepared with an accountant experienced in EB-5 matters—will help you avoid financial surprises and ensure you’re fully prepared for all expenses.
3. Do You Understand the Risks and Returns?
While the EB-5 visa offers a direct path to U.S. permanent residency, investment returns are not guaranteed. Assess the risks of your chosen project and weigh them against the potential benefits. For a balanced view, see the pros and cons of citizenship by investment.
4. Have You Chosen the Right Immigration Attorney?
A reputable immigration attorney with a proven EB-5 track record is invaluable. They can streamline your application, ensure compliance with USCIS regulations, and help you avoid common pitfalls.
5. Is the EB-5 Path Right for You and Your Family?
The EB-5 visa is the most expensive route to a U.S. green card. Consider whether this aligns with your long-term goals. If not, explore EB-5 visa alternatives or other global investment migration options.
6. Have You Considered Other Investment Destinations?
The U.S. isn’t the only country offering investment-based residency or citizenship. Programs in Europe, the Caribbean, and beyond may better suit your objectives. Discover the cheapest citizenship by investment programs for more options.
7. Do You Understand U.S. Tax Implications?
Becoming a U.S. tax resident can impact your global tax liability. Consult a tax advisor familiar with U.S. laws to optimize your tax planning and avoid unexpected liabilities. For more, see EB-5 visa tax planning.
EB-5 Visa Planning Checklist
A structured checklist ensures you don’t overlook any critical steps. Here’s a concise guide to keep your EB-5 application on track:
- Assess eligibility: Confirm you meet all EB-5 requirements.
- Budget comprehensively: Include all fees and potential costs.
- Select a credible regional center: Research EB-5 regional centers with a strong track record.
- Engage expert advisors: Hire experienced legal and financial professionals.
- Prepare documentation: Gather all required financial and personal records.
- Understand timelines: Be aware of processing times and plan accordingly.
- Plan for contingencies: Develop backup strategies for potential delays or issues.
- Stay informed: Monitor regulatory updates and program changes.
